On Our Own of Cecil County will be holding a quit smoking class in the month of October provided by the Elkton Health Department.
The possible dates for the four day class is October 5, 12, 19 and 20 from 1:00-2:00. If interested please give us a call 410-392-4228 to sign up. Hours of operation are Monday through Friday 9:00-3:00.

The mission of On Our Own Of Cecil County Inc, is to encourage wellness recovery and respect to all, empowering individuals with psychiatric disabilities to reach their maximum potential through advocacy and peer support.We serve people who have been diagnosed or think they have addictions or any other psychiatric disorders. We encourage self-help by providing education, information and referral to community agencies and services. On Our Own Of Cecil County Inc. moves forward along with the current mental movement.
